I'll second the advice toward the I6. Certainly the V8 has the power
(approx 1 sec quicker to 100KPH), but it's a function of how often you
want/need the extra performance versus the price you pay (higher initial
cost, higher fuel bills, higher maintenance costs, and somewhat reduced
reliability). You might find a 2001 530 for a similar price to the 2000
540. Whatever you choose, I'd put a premium on well-documented maintenance
(above and beyond recommended intervals for oil changes) and low miles.

Re sport suspension. If poor roads are a significant factor, go with
standard suspension. The lower profile tires and somewhat stiffer
suspension of the sport will make for an unpleasant ride. Handling won't
quite be there, but it's still the best of class. I've taken my 530 SP over
some abominable roads (fortunately not a frequent occurrence) and didn't
like the experience.
